package market
import (
"bytes"
"github.com/filecoin-project/go-address"
"github.com/filecoin-project/go-state-types/abi"
"github.com/filecoin-project/lotus/chain/actors/adt"
"github.com/filecoin-project/lotus/chain/types"
"github.com/filecoin-project/specs-actors/actors/builtin/market"
v0adt "github.com/filecoin-project/specs-actors/actors/util/adt"
cbg "github.com/whyrusleeping/cbor-gen"
)
type v0State struct {
market.State
store adt.Store
}
func (s *v0State) TotalLocked() (abi.TokenAmount, error) {
fml := types.BigAdd(s.TotalClientLockedCollateral, s.TotalProviderLockedCollateral)
fml = types.BigAdd(fml, s.TotalClientStorageFee)
return fml, nil
}
func (s *v0State) BalancesChanged(otherState State) bool {
v0otherState, ok := otherState.(*v0State)
if !ok {
// there's no way to compare differnt versions of the state, so let's
// just say that means the state of balances has changed
return true
}
return !s.State.EscrowTable.Equals(v0otherState.State.EscrowTable) || !s.State.LockedTable.Equals(v0otherState.State.LockedTable)
}
func (s *v0State) StatesChanged(otherState State) bool {
v0otherState, ok := otherState.(*v0State)
if !ok {
// there's no way to compare differnt versions of the state, so let's
// just say that means the state of balances has changed
return true
}
return !s.State.States.Equals(v0otherState.State.States)
}
func (s *v0State) States() (DealStates, error) {
stateArray, err := v0adt.AsArray(s.store, s.State.States)
if err != nil {
return nil, err
}
return &v0DealStates{stateArray}, nil
}
func (s *v0State) ProposalsChanged(otherState State) bool {
v0otherState, ok := otherState.(*v0State)
if !ok {
// there's no way to compare differnt versions of the state, so let's
// just say that means the state of balances has changed
return true
}
return !s.State.Proposals.Equals(v0otherState.State.Proposals)
}
func (s *v0State) Proposals() (DealProposals, error) {
proposalArray, err := v0adt.AsArray(s.store, s.State.Proposals)
if err != nil {
return nil, err
}
return &v0DealProposals{proposalArray}, nil
}
func (s *v0State) EscrowTable() (BalanceTable, error) {
bt, err := v0adt.AsBalanceTable(s.store, s.State.EscrowTable)
if err != nil {
return nil, err
}
return &v0BalanceTable{bt}, nil
}
func (s *v0State) LockedTable() (BalanceTable, error) {
bt, err := v0adt.AsBalanceTable(s.store, s.State.LockedTable)
if err != nil {
return nil, err
}
return &v0BalanceTable{bt}, nil
}
func (s *v0State) VerifyDealsForActivation(
minerAddr address.Address, deals []abi.DealID, currEpoch, sectorExpiry abi.ChainEpoch,
) (weight, verifiedWeight abi.DealWeight, err error) {
return market.ValidateDealsForActivation(&s.State, s.store, deals, minerAddr, sectorExpiry, currEpoch)
}
type v0BalanceTable struct {
*v0adt.BalanceTable
}
func (bt *v0BalanceTable) ForEach(cb func(address.Address, abi.TokenAmount) error) error {
asMap := (*v0adt.Map)(bt.BalanceTable)
var ta abi.TokenAmount
return asMap.ForEach(&ta, func(key string) error {
a, err := address.NewFromBytes([]byte(key))
if err != nil {
return err
}
return cb(a, ta)
})
}
type v0DealStates struct {
adt.Array
}
func (s *v0DealStates) Get(dealID abi.DealID) (*DealState, bool, error) {
var v0deal market.DealState
found, err := s.Array.Get(uint64(dealID), &v0deal)
if err != nil {
return nil, false, err
}
if !found {
return nil, false, nil
}
deal := fromV0DealState(v0deal)
return &deal, true, nil
}
func (s *v0DealStates) decode(val *cbg.Deferred) (*DealState, error) {
var v0ds market.DealState
if err := v0ds.UnmarshalCBOR(bytes.NewReader(val.Raw)); err != nil {
return nil, err
}
ds := fromV0DealState(v0ds)
return &ds, nil
}
func (s *v0DealStates) array() adt.Array {
return s.Array
}
func fromV0DealState(v0 market.DealState) DealState {
return (DealState)(v0)
}
type v0DealProposals struct {
adt.Array
}
func (s *v0DealProposals) Get(dealID abi.DealID) (*DealProposal, bool, error) {
var v0proposal market.DealProposal
found, err := s.Array.Get(uint64(dealID), &v0proposal)
if err != nil {
return nil, false, err
}
if !found {
return nil, false, nil
}
proposal := fromV0DealProposal(v0proposal)
return &proposal, true, nil
}
func (s *v0DealProposals) ForEach(cb func(dealID abi.DealID, dp DealProposal) error) error {
var v0dp market.DealProposal
return s.Array.ForEach(&v0dp, func(idx int64) error {
return cb(abi.DealID(idx), fromV0DealProposal(v0dp))
})
}
func (s *v0DealProposals) decode(val *cbg.Deferred) (*DealProposal, error) {
var v0dp market.DealProposal
if err := v0dp.UnmarshalCBOR(bytes.NewReader(val.Raw)); err != nil {
return nil, err
}
dp := fromV0DealProposal(v0dp)
return &dp, nil
}
func (s *v0DealProposals) array() adt.Array {
return s.Array
}
func fromV0DealProposal(v0 market.DealProposal) DealProposal {
return (DealProposal)(v0)
}
